2 2 Bruker microct method note: Dataviewer registration Introduction Starting from version , DataViewer provides tools for intensity-based image registration for both 2D and 3D. Two sets of images are required as input: a reference image which stays stationary, and a target image which needs to be transformed to match the reference image. The target image and reference image are not required to have the same matrix size or pixel size. Currently only rigid transformation is used to transform the target image (x/y/z translations, 3D rotation). A pseudo-3d registration method is used to speed up the process. Instead of searching all 6 parameters simultaneously using the 3D volumes, the searching task is broken up into smaller and easier steps. The viewing option in Dataviewer displays three orthogonal views at any given location: the x-y plane (transaxial view), the x-z plane (coronal view) and the z-y plane (rotated sagittal view). A 2D registration is performed (two shifts and one rotation) on each of the views iteratively to achieve volume registration. The number of loops is default set to 3, which works fine in most cases. One can change this number in the options. If the improvement becomes very small, the registration will stop automatically before the number of loops is done. Due to the decomposition of a 3D task to many 2D tasks, the registration can be done almost instantly in a semi-automatic fashion. This implies that re-sampling is unavoidable. In practice To open the 2D or 3D registration module in dataviewer, go to Actions 2D registration or 3D registration. A new window will appear and the normal image control window will be toggled off. For the first time use of this function, you might need to re-adjust the window size so that all controls are shown properly. This window is a "floating window", meaning that it cannot be attached to the main window, but it can be toggled on and off at any time. Page 2 of 6

3 3 Bruker microct method note: Dataviewer registration For 2D registration, two images are needed: a reference image and a target image. For 3D registration, two datasets are needed: a reference image volume and a target image volume. During registration, the target is transformed into the coordinate system of the reference which stays stationary. By double-clicking the corresponding line in the list with left mouse button, one can browse to select the corresponding image/dataset. Once both images/datasets are selected, one can load by clicking the Load button. In this case, a scan of expanded clay was loaded; one scan was acquired in dry condition (reference) and one after moistening (target). Figure 1. 2D Pseudo-colored reconstructed slices (not registered) of the expanded clay before (upper panel) and after (lower panel) moistening. Empty pores are represented in black (background), pores filled with water in purple. Page 3 of 6

4 4 Bruker microct method note: Dataviewer registration The screen image shown in figure 2 will be displayed when the reference and target image volumes are loaded successfully. Once loaded, the target image and reference image can be displayed either individually (figure 1) or as fused image (figure 2), by clicking on the corresponding line in the list. In the fusion mode, a slider is provided to vary the weights (blending). The images are shown in the main window as 3 orthogonal views: the x-y view at bottom-left, the x-z view at top and the z-y view at right. To visually examine how good the registration is, one can alternate between target and reference images, or view the fusion images with various settings. Alternatively, you can also check the profile along any line (right-mouse click and drag). Figure 2. Screenshot before registration (overlay), Datasets are from an expanded clay granule before (reference) and after (target) moistening. White represents material that was removed upon treatment, black represents new material (water or removed clay) and material represented in grey remained unchanged. To speed up the registration, it is generally recommended to shift/rotate the target image first manually so that the 2 sets of images are sufficiently close to each other, before using the automatic function. The target image can be shifted and rotated manually using the arrow buttons, using keyboard shortcuts (see below for detailed Page 4 of 6

5 5 Bruker microct method note: Dataviewer registration key combinations) or simply by holding down the CTRL key and rotating the target image using the left mouse button (cfr repositioning data in Dataviewer). There are 3 sets of arrow buttons. Each of them corresponds to a given view: the controls and the views are arranged in the same way topologically. You can alter the shift/rotation steps using button Options. Finally, the registration can be done automatically using buttons R for each view individually and Register all for all views. The searching range can be altered using button Options. # * # * Figure 3. Screenshot (overlay) of the expanded clay datasets after registration (compare to figure 1). Pores that were filled with water are represented in dark (new material, indicated by *), whereas pores that were not filled are represented in light grey (indicated by #). Page 5 of 6

6 6 Bruker microct method note: Dataviewer registration Note that the registration or matching is done within the Volume Of Interest (VOI), which can be defined interactively. The smaller the VOI, the faster the calculation will be. The VOI is chosen based on intuition: for the automatic registration to succeed, it should contain similar and clear structures in both volumes. To keep the transformation parameters, three actions are provided: Reset, Reload and Keep. The parameters can be kept in the original log file (if absent, a log file will be created) in the target dataset. Reload would simply read the parameters back and apply the transformation. Reset is to discard all shifts and rotations in the current session. Once the parameters are saved in the log file, they will be loaded back automatically when you open the same set of data back again for 3D registration. Once the images are registered, the Save button will allow you to save the transformed images. It saves optionally also the reference volume. This makes sense if there is resampling during loading. A difference image can be saved too. The grey values in the difference image are calculated as such: Diff = (256 + target reference) / 2. The resulting images will be saved in the sub-folder /Registration in the target folder (automatically created if absent).
